Amul aka Anand Milk Union Limited, a co-operative which boasts of more than 2 million milk producers under its wing, is probably the biggest organization of its kind. Amul’s products have been iconic even since its inception. Amul’s brand name is every marketers dream, replacing the primary commodity (butter ) in some cases. People don’t ask for butter they ask for amul butter.

Amuls doodle’s on the back of their cover’s is also one of the most symbolic contributions to the culture of the times. Most of their covers depict a current event and a subtle but buttery take on it. Here’s one of the earliest ones, followed by one of the latest ones
